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H 03/10] hw: Use CFI_PFLASH0{1, 2} and TYPE_CFI_PFLASH0{1, 2}
Date: Mon, 18 Feb 2019 13:56:08 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190218125615.18970-4-armbru@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190218125615.18970-1-armbru@redhat.com>

We have two open-coded copies of macro CFI_PFLASH01().  Move the macro
to the header, so we can ditch the copies.  Move CFI_PFLASH02() to the
header for symmetry.

We define macros TYPE_CFI_PFLASH01 and TYPE_CFI_PFLASH02 for type name
strings, then mostly use the strings.  If the macros are worth
defining, they are worth using.  Replace the strings by the macros.
